I just cooked up a batch using the basic methods-Everyone's idea will get a chance-I split two thighs and legs, washed them and rolled them in a flour/pepper/garlic and onion powder/season salt mix.

I heated up a steel skillet and dropped them in. I did one side for 15 minutes, flipped them and did 10 minutes, then flipped once more and did a 7 minute turn.

I popped them out and the are cooling at the moment. I took a piece of skin off and it was good-I have to 'adjust' my spice level-it was a little underseasoned from the test, I have to look into this!
